For most people, Thanksgiving is also a day about spending time with family members or friends together and enjoying delicious food. If you would like to host a good dinner party for all the people you love, you really need to make the advanced preparation right now. Actually, there are many things you can do before Thanksgiving walks into your house and welcome it with twinkle in your eyes.
1.Finalize the Guest List
Are you planning to host a big dinner or just a small one? You need to draft a name list of the people you want to invite, so that you can have everything in control such as how much food needed, how many tables and wine glasses, etc. Advance planning is always good to pin down what you’re getting yourself into!
2.Check Your Cooking and Serving Gear
Another most important thing is to review your recipes, making sure that you are stay on the budget and reduce the waste. For example, how many people are there, how many courses you are going to make, what ingredients you will need. Beside, think through the cooking gears, do you need a roasting pan or a potato ricer? Additionally, check if there are enough serving ware such as bowls, dishes, forks, spoons and plates.
3.Clean Your Fridge and Freezer
Chances are that you will buy lots of ingredients ahead of time. Hence, it is necessary to clean your fridge and freezer for keeping the materials under sanitary conditions. You can accomplish this task about a week before Thanksgiving.
4.Clean the Oven
As we all know, a clean oven cooks food better while the dirty one will probably give off bad smell. It is too bad, especially when you are cooking the big turkey. Besides, it is the best to clean the oven around 10 days ahead of the Thanksgiving day, so as to let the smell to disappear from the air.
